33 They replied, “We’re stoning you not for any good work, but for blasphemy! You, a mere man, claim to be God.”

34 Jesus replied, “It is written in your own Scriptures[a] that God said to certain leaders of the people, ‘I say, you are gods!’[b] 35 And you know that the Scriptures cannot be altered. So if those people who received God’s message were called ‘gods,’ 36 why do you call it blasphemy when I say, ‘I am the Son of God’? After all, the Father set me apart and sent me into the world. 37 Don’t believe me unless I carry out my Father’s work. 38 But if I do his work, believe in the evidence of the miraculous works I have done, even if you don’t believe me. Then you will know and understand that the Father is in me, and I am in the Father.”

33 The Jews answered Him, “We are not stoning You for a good work, but for (A)blasphemy; and because You, being a man, (B)make Yourself out to be God.” 34 Jesus answered them, “Has it not been written in (C)your (D)Law: ‘(E)I said, you are gods’? 35 If he called them gods, to whom the word of God came (and the Scripture cannot be nullified), 36 are you saying of Him whom the Father (F)sanctified and (G)sent into the world, ‘You are blaspheming,’ because I said, ‘(H)I am the Son of God’? 37 (I)If I do not do the works of My Father, do not believe Me; 38 but if I do them, even though you do not believe Me, believe (J)the works, so that you may [a]know and understand that (K)the Father is in Me, and I in the Father.”
